Brewery's commitments to sake making

Tatsuriki Honda Store
The only right way to brew sake
Based on the concept that “rice sake should taste like rice,” we've thoroughly researched Yamada Nishiki soil characteristics (Terroir) and sake rice (the ideal rice for sake making) to produce our Ginjo sake. You can taste the fact that we use nothing but specialized sake-brewing rice in our sake.

History and culture of the brewery

Tatsuriki Honda Store
Japan’s first exclusive contract with farmers
We signed Japan’s first exclusive contract with farmers to designate farming methods, and we have been polishing our own rice for over 30 years using methods such as flat rice polishing. We have also been working on Ginjo sake brewing for over 40 years. We were involved before the process even took shape. Now we are working on independently researching new sake rice varieties and sake maturing methods to create new value.

Harima’s climate and natural environment

Tatsuriki Honda Store
Harimaʼs grain-producing region has vast areas of mineral-rich clay agricultural land, and there are large daily temperature variations during the period when rice grains are ripening. This climate and the natural environment positively impact the Yamada-Nishiki rice in terms of the shape of the shinpaku and the low levels of fat and protein, making this rice variety an excellent raw material for brewing sake.

See Company Information

Company name Honda Shoten Co., Inc.
Address 361-1 Takata, Aboshi-ku, Himeji-shi, Hyogo
Founded 1921
Representative Shinichiro Honda
Others

Awards

Registered vegan in 2020
2021Annual Japan Sake Awards Gold Award
IWC 2021 (England) Gold & Trophy
US National Sake Appraisal (United States) 2021 Gold
Féminalise World Wine Competition 2021 (France) Gold
KuraMaster2021 (France) Gold
